What is IRS Form 1099-INT?

0

Form 1099-INT is sent to inform taxpayers of taxable interest that they have earned. This form will be sent by any bank or other institution that has paid a taxpayer at least $10 in interest during the year. If any interest has been withheld to pay taxes, that will be noted. The amount of tax-exempt interest will also be shown. Some interest on US savings bonds and other debt instruments will not be taxable at the federal, state, and/or local levels. Certain other expenses and taxes paid or owed will also be included.
